Description

This early manual is a fascinating read for any farming enthusiast or historian, but also contains much information that is still useful and practical today. It is extensively illustrated with drawings and diagrams, forming a complete how-to guide to sheep farming. An absorbing work that is thoroughly recommended for inclusion on the bookshelf of all farmers and historians of agriculture. Contents: Introduction; Breeds of Sheep; The Sheep Year; Systems of Sheep Farming; Food for Thought; Wool; Sheep Diseases and Ailments; The Feeding of Sheep; Labour, Capital and Returns. This book contains classic material dating back to the 1900s and before. The content has been carefully selected for its interest and relevance to a modern audience.
